In the ever-evolving food industry, future-proofing food traceability has become a critical aspect of ensuring safety and efficiency. With the increasing demand for data-driven decision-making, technology implementation, and secure systems, various roles are in high demand in the UK. Here's a closer look at some of these roles and their significance in the industry: 1. **Data Scientist**: Data scientists play a crucial role in making sense of large datasets, enabling organizations to make informed decisions about food traceability. Their skills in statistical analysis and machine learning contribute significantly to identifying trends, predicting future issues, and optimizing processes. 2. **Software Developer**: Software developers are responsible for designing and implementing the software solutions that enable seamless food traceability. They build custom applications, integrate third-party tools, and maintain existing systems that support the collection, management, and analysis of food traceability data. 3. **Supply Chain Manager**: Supply chain managers oversee the end-to-end food supply chain, ensuring that products move efficiently and safely from production to consumption. They are responsible for implementing traceability systems, monitoring performance, and addressing any potential issues that may arise during the process. 4. **Cybersecurity Specialist**: Cybersecurity specialists protect food traceability systems from unauthorized access, data breaches, and other security threats. With the increasing adoption of digital tools and systems in the food industry, their role in ensuring data integrity and confidentiality has become increasingly important. 5. **Blockchain Developer**: Blockchain developers work on implementing decentralized ledger technology solutions for food traceability, enhancing transparency, and tamper-proof records. Their expertise in blockchain development contributes to improved trust and collaboration among stakeholders in the food supply chain. 6. **Quality Assurance Manager**: Quality assurance managers ensure that food products meet the required standards and regulations. They oversee testing, inspection, and validation processes, ensuring that food traceability systems are effective and reliable. 7. **Business Intelligence Analyst**: Business intelligence analysts analyze food traceability data to provide actionable insights to help organizations optimize their operations, reduce costs, and improve overall performance.
